What Does SSL Indicate?

SSL (Secure Sockets Layer) is a technology that protects your web store or sign-on page. The Secure Sockets Layer certificates, also known as digital certificates, encrypt the delicate details required from web site visitors such as place of residence, date of birth, national insurance number, driver's license or bank account info, so that nobody could use this info for illegal purposes.

Your web site guests can identify a protected web site by the ‘https' component at the beginning of the site address, or by the lock symbol in the web browser window, or by a special seal on the website.
